Do we have updated timeline for Harvey-Pinard, Laine, Slafkovsky and Guhle?
Slaf/Guhle were practising in non-contact jersey at the morning skate yesterday.
Slaf should be revaluated for Tuesday game based on what they announced.
Guhle migth be a bit longer, first time he skated since he got injured.

Laine is on track for his 2-3 months, stopped wearing the big brace. Should start skating solo soon. Should be back somewhere in December.

RHP was supposed to be back around December too, already started to skate solo so that's on track.
